Question: I'm freaking out about this numbness...?
Okay, I went to the Dentist a few hours ( 2-3 ) and they gave me 3 shots of novocaine above my left canine tooth, and I'm still having numbness all the way up to my left eye and that side of my face is almost completely paralyzed. I am freaking the hell out, is it supposed to numb your actual EYE? It's hard for me to blink. Normal or not?

Answers:

Best Answer - Chosen by Voters

The numbness should be gone in 3 - 4 hours.



Canines are often called eye teeth because they have long roots. Considering the amount of novocaine, and the fact that you're more than likely not used to novocaine the numbness will hang out for a few hours. Your dentist probably injected using the block method which is a method that numbs a large area. It will wear off soon, this is normal.
